Key Buying Factors for Decolletage Firming Lotion

Active Ingredients

Look for ingredients that match your goal. Retinol and retinol-like ingredients are commonly used for smoothing texture, while peptides, collagen, Q10, and hyaluronic acid are popular for moisturizing and supporting a firmer-looking appearance. If your skin is sensitive, start with gentler hydrators and build up slowly.

Texture and Absorption

The neck and chest area can feel uncomfortable with heavy or greasy formulas. A fast-absorbing lotion is ideal if you want to layer makeup or sunscreen on top. If your skin feels tight, a richer cream may deliver better comfort and longer-lasting hydration.

Skin Type and Sensitivity

Dry, mature, or crepey skin often benefits from more emollient formulas, while normal to oily skin may prefer lighter lotions or gel creams. If you are prone to irritation, avoid over-layering active ingredients and patch test first.

Day Vs. Night Use

Some Decolletage Firming Lotion formulas are better suited to nighttime because they contain retinol or richer textures. For daytime, choose a formula that sits well under sunscreen and clothing without pilling.
